Whats the beauty standard of today? 
having a dark skinned you will always be labeled as poor, dirty and will always be the bad guy in a movie, which doesn’t really make sense. is having a lighter skin better?
Picture
Picture
Whats its like to be dark skinned in a world that tells you light is beautiful?
i have always been teased for having a darker skin, like when they turned off the light  they would say, “Oh Louie, Nasan kana?” [Hey Louie, where did you go?] or  Smile so we can see you LOL
Picture
One of the main reasons why people see lighter-skinned individuals as more desirable is because those are the kinds of faces they see in media – advertisements, music videos and much more
Picture
If i have a lighter skin will i have a better life?
Looking back, I would have told my younger teenage self to snap out of it, because my skin tone and complexion should not determine my worth.
Picture
I am beautiful! I am [Medj] perfect just the way i am, my skin color is a gift its never been a blemish or a problem.
